BL53 ZCU is a 2004 Ford Fiesta in Red with a 1,242cc petrol engine. This vehicle has been through 25 MOT tests with a personal pass rate of 80%.

Across all 2004 Ford Fiesta models, the average MOT pass rate is 72.6% with a typical mileage of 64,638 miles. This particular vehicle has performed better than the average for its year.

The most common reason a Ford Fiesta fails its MOT is tyre tread depth below requirements of 1.6mm, accounting for 959,538 recorded failures. If you're considering buying BL53 ZCU, it's worth having these areas checked by a mechanic before committing.

The Ford Fiesta typically stays on UK roads for around 34 years. At 22 years old, this Ford Fiesta is well into its expected lifespan but still has years ahead.
